Yule Logs
Recipe GLPRd303646e7c43a7
A rich chocolate sponge cake rolled into festive logs, perfect for holiday celebrations. Light, airy layers of chocolate cake wrapped around a delicate center create an elegant dessert with a tender crumb and deep cocoa flavor. Traditionally enjoyed during the winter season in Nordic countries.

Ingredients
Vegetable oil cooking spray
6 count Large eggs, separated (egg whites)
6 count Large eggs, separated (egg yolks)
¾ cup Granulated sugar
¼ cup Unsweetened cocoa powder
¼ cup All-purpose flour
Directions
Preheat your oven to 375°F. Lightly coat a 9x13-inch baking sheet with vegetable oil cooking spray, then line it with parchment paper and spray the parchment as well.
In a medium bowl, whisk together the cocoa powder and all-purpose flour until well combined with no lumps.
In a separate large bowl, beat the 6 egg yolks with 1/2 cup of the granulated sugar until the mixture is pale yellow and thick, about 3-4 minutes. Gently fold the cocoa-flour mixture into the yolks until just combined.
In another large, very clean bowl, whip the 6 egg whites with an electric mixer until soft peaks form. Gradually add the remaining 1/4 cup of sugar while continuing to beat until stiff, glossy peaks form.
Carefully fold one-third of the egg white mixture into the chocolate batter to lighten it, then gently fold in the remaining whites in two additions, preserving as much volume as possible.
Pour the batter onto the prepared baking sheet and spread evenly. Bake for 10-12 minutes, until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ean and the cake is springy to the touch.
Remove the cake from the oven and let cool for 2 minutes. Carefully turn the warm cake out onto a clean kitchen towel dusted with a light coating of cocoa powder.
While still warm and pliable, tightly roll the cake with the towel, starting from a long edge. Set aside seam-side down and allow to cool completely, about 20-30 minutes.
Once cooled, unroll the cake gently and cut into 2 equal portions. Roll each portion into a log shape and transfer to a serving plate. Dust lightly with additional cocoa powder if desired before serving.
